Quarterly Planning Note — Divestiture of the Coastal Tooling Unit

For the finance team: the sale of the Coastal Tooling unit to Pellmark Industries remains on track for close in Q3. Please finalize the carve-out balance sheet, reconcile intercompany positions, and prepare the working-capital adjustment schedule by month-end. Audit support requests should be prioritized. For planning purposes, note the following sensitive item:

internal memo for hawef-kahif: The finance team signed off on a budget of $25.9 million for Project Sorox. The renewal with Pelokek Logistics closes at $51.7 million a year, 52 percent below the last contract.

## Local Setup

Hey support folks — to poke at undo/redo issues in Plotnik, clone the repo, run the bootstrap script, and launch the editor in dev mode. Undo history is persisted per-session, so you can replay exactly what a user saw. Most tickets boil down to a corrupted history record. To check those records yourself, connect to the local history DB with this string.

replica DSN, kajep-yahag: mssql://praok_svc:iF@db-8d68.plorvaio.local:5432/eliion

// Autocomplete index constants — Murkwater suggest service.
// Index rebuilds have been slow since the Tarnview dataset doubled.
// Symptoms: suggest latency spikes during merge windows, queue backlog
// alarms around rebuild time. Mitigation is already wired in: merges
// are throttled, prefix shards are capped, and stale reads are allowed
// during compaction. Do NOT raise the merge parallelism without paging
// the search platform rotation first — it starves query threads.
// Current tuning values follow.

tuning table, kajog-kawef:
PRIORITIES = {
    "kelox": 870,
    "kasix": 89,
    "eliax": 988,
}